Introducing Envision Glasses: AI-powered Low Vision for the Blind & Visually Impaired.
The technology built into Envision Low Vision Glasses uses the power of speech to make everyday life more accessible for anyone with any visual impairment.
Envision Low Vision Glasses is a wearable device that significantly improves the daily life of blind and visually impaired people. It provides the most intuitive and easiest way to access all kinds of visual information around them. It’s trained to recognize and speak out text, objects, people, colors, products and so much more. The Envision Glasses are designed to be worn all day with their comfortable, lightweight profile.
The glasses come with two kinds of frames:
- Standard Titanium Frame: a lightweight minimal frame with no lenses.
- Smith Optics Frame: the designer spectacle frame with zero-power lenses you can replace with custom prescription lenses.
The Envision Low Vision Glasses are a combination of the Google Glass 2 and Envision’s award-winning AI technology. The technology, currently available on iOS and Android smartphones, already enables you and thousands of other users around the world to read all kinds of information. Like the app, the glasses use artificial intelligence to understand the world around you and speak the visual information back to you.
